Loss Of Rights

Featured Replies

Does anyone know the details about what happens to people who don't vote? I just got married and I noticed in all the government buildings they have forms to fill out to rat on people who haven't voted. I just got back from the honeymoon yesterday and my wife is worried from all that she has heard about loss of rights and how difficult the government will make things for you infuture if you didn't vote.

There was a thread on this last week. I asked my wife and she said that most of the sanctions were not enforced. There are no losses to educational rights for the person or children. She wasn't 100% sure about loss of 30 Baht health care.

What came through from her was that life could be made more difficult in dealings with the amphur, thetsabaan or the police. She reckoned there's a central computer file of those who didn't vote. The general feeling is that if you didn't help your country by voting, then it's not going to help you.

I still know plenty of people who didn't vote though. Couldn't be bothered to travel back to their family's province.
